Coverage Report

Created: 2025-09-05 06:52

/src/serenity/Userland/Libraries/LibWeb/DOM/DocumentLoadEventDelayer.cpp
Line
Count
Source (jump to first uncovered line)
1
/*
2
 * Copyright (c) 2021, Andreas Kling <kling@serenityos.org>
3
 *
4
 * SPDX-License-Identifier: BSD-2-Clause
5
 */
6
7
#include <LibWeb/DOM/Document.h>
8
#include <LibWeb/DOM/DocumentLoadEventDelayer.h>
9
10
namespace Web::DOM {
11
12
DocumentLoadEventDelayer::DocumentLoadEventDelayer(Document& document)
13
0
    : m_document(JS::make_handle(document))
14
0
{
15
0
    m_document->increment_number_of_things_delaying_the_load_event({});
16
0
}
17
18
DocumentLoadEventDelayer::~DocumentLoadEventDelayer()
19
0
{
20
0
    m_document->decrement_number_of_things_delaying_the_load_event({});
21
0
}
22
23
}